Hello everyone! I have a question regarding showing columns in a table when a slicer is selected.
I have this code, which works fine when the slicer is selected. It's showing the data from one customer as the Sales Data table has one row for each Customer and their respective sales data. I had to use Sum to get the data to show up even though there is only one row.
Balance = IF(
HASONEFILTER('Sales Data'[CustomerName]),
SUM(AR[balance_due]),
BLANK()
)
Now, I'm trying to show the Customer Name in the same table mentioned above. Here's the code I've written after a few iterations of trying to get it to work:
Customer = IF(
HASONEFILTER('Sales Data'[CustomerName]),
CONCATENATEX(VALUES(AR[customer_name]),
BLANK()
))
But nothing seems to be working. I just want the Customer Name, Balance Due and a few other values to show up when one item is selected in the Slicer.

Hi @RAdams
Concatenatex takes atleast two arguments ...first argument a table or an expression that returns a table. The second argument is a column that contains the values you want to concatenate, or an expression that returns a value.
Try this
Customer = IF ( HASONEFILTER ( 'Sales Data'[CustomerName] ), CONCATENATEX ( VALUES ( AR[customer_name] ), AR[customer_name] ), BLANK () )
